Jocasta Williams
In polling in EchoVideo, I can export 'grades' based on whether someone answered a poll or not which is really useful. In EchoPoll, this isn't possible - values are only awarded if they answered something correctly as a scored question. I want to be able to award a participation grade, without needing to know if they were correct or not.
